Transaction 0530844969a2a74dc088f76506684219a2babc40146ff878f9079d6c225f8d21

1 Input
2 Outputs
  • 0530844969a2a74dc088f76506684219a2babc40146ff878f9079d6c225f8d21:0
  • value  1821947
    address  3MVFXY8LQn71BkMrYPhBmYgw9Vf1A58tpv
  • 0530844969a2a74dc088f76506684219a2babc40146ff878f9079d6c225f8d21:1
  • value  1405530866
    address  bc1qxqaa8wwhf4cxneentql2xg9zv4lyjuzztzqysp